Output 20c8edc1a322829d11bfc63ce11df2dff26a4a674460aeb76c52650eda3e287c:1

value
2261897
script pubkey
OP_0 OP_PUSHBYTES_20 5e09c8472a046965d42988f14a043a0aa2d9adca
address
bc1qtcyus3e2q35kt4pf3rc55pp6p23dntw253vfxs
transaction
20c8edc1a322829d11bfc63ce11df2dff26a4a674460aeb76c52650eda3e287c
confirmations
17089
spent
true